>>>> I seem to be having an issue when using <resource-bundle> in my
>>>> portlet.xml.  This is what I have observed.
>>>>
>>>> The portlet description and information does not appear when you edit a
>>>> page
>>>> and try to add a portlet using the Add Portlet page.  It just shows
>>>> blank
>>>> information next to the icon and above the Add link.  Also, the keywords
>>>> from the resource bundle don't work. If you put the same information
>>>> directly into the portlet.xml, it shows up and works fine on the Add
>>>> Portlet
>>>> page.
>>>>
>>>> When you add the portlet, the title shows up fine using the resource
>>>> bundle.
>>>>
>>>>
>>>> The Portlet Application Manager appears to get the resource bundle
>>>> information OK, at least the first time the portlet is deployed. When
>>>> viewing the portlet details, the PortletDetailsManager shows the
>>>> correction
>>>> information on the Languages tab.  However, if you redeploy your portlet
>>>> with changes to the resource information, it is not picked up and
>>>> continues
>>>> to show the information from the first deployment. I've tried several
>>>> variations on redeploying, delete the portlet webapp, restarting without
>>>> much luck here.  Seems only after building our custom portal with a
>>>> target=all the new info is picked up.
>>>>
>>>> Here is my resource bundle:
>>>> javax.portlet.title=SimplePortletTitle
>>>> javax.portlet.short-title=SimpleShortTitle
>>>> javax.portlet.description=This is a simple portlet example
>>>> javax.portlet.display-name=SimpleDisplayName
>>>> javax.portlet.keywords=simple,sample,spring
>>>>
>>>> Here is my portlet.xml file
>>>> <?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>
>>>> <portlet-app id='vs-demo'
>>>>    xmlns="http://java.sun.com/xml/ns/portlet/portlet-app_2_0.xsd";
>>>> version="2.0"
>>>>    xmlns:xsi="http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ema-instance";
>>>>    xsi:schemaLocation="
>>>> http://java.sun.com/xml/ns/portlet/portlet-app_2_0.xsd
>>>> http://java.sun.com/xml/ns/portlet/portlet-app_2_0.xsd";>
>>>>
>>>>    <portlet>
>>>>        <portlet-name>simpleportlet</portlet-name>
>>>>
>>>> <portlet-class>org.springframework.web.portlet.DispatcherPortlet</portlet-class>
>>>>
>>>>        <init-param>
>>>>            <name>contextConfigLocation</name>
>>>>            <value>/WEB-INF/context/simpleportlet.xml</value>
>>>>        </init-param>
>>>>        <supports>
>>>>            <mime-type>text/html</mime-type>
>>>>            <portlet-mode>VIEW</portlet-mode>
>>>>            <portlet-mode>HELP</portlet-mode>
>>>>        </supports>
>>>>        <resource-bundle>com.sample.simpleportlet</resource-bundle>
>>>>    </portlet>
>>>>
>>>> </portlet-app>
>>>>
>>>> Any help would be appreciated.  Thanks.
